Proposal of Few-Mode Multi-core Fiber with Air Hole Assisted Double Cladding Structure

Abstract(in English) We have proposed hole assisted double cladding multi-core fiber which can drastically suppress the crosstalk between cores and reduce the core pitch have. However, since the adjacent core region is almost contacted, further increase of packing density of core is difficult. Therefore, to increase the transmission channel in the multi-core fiber, we propose a few-mode multi-core fiber with air hole assisted double cladding structure.
